GUWAHATI, July 25, 2018: A couple from Assam were found dead on Tuesday morning, in a suspected case of suicide within their rented room at St Inez, Panaji. Their bodies were found by their neighbours early Tuesday morning after which police were alerted and a team was rushed to the site.
Additional charge of the Panjim Police Station, Inspector Sudesh Velip, said that the couple has been identified as Shrimanta Borah, 31 years, and Rimpi Borah, 22 years, were found dead and a preliminary investigation reveals the case is suicide.

"The man was found hanging while the woman was lying dead on the bed. There is no suicide note but it is suspected to be a case of suicide. Exact cause will be known only after the post mortem examination," he said.

Police sources have said that the bodies has been sent for autopsy and that the actual cause of death would only be determined after the postmortem reports were out.

The two were residing at Chincholim in Taleigao. The police are also recording statements of witnesses.

The couple were residing near the TB Hospital at St Inez and had come to Goa two years ago. Both are natives of Assam. Shrimanta was employed as a security guard at a starred hotel and Rimpi was working at a stall in a mall, a few meters away from her husband's place of work.
